Why do my windows fog up in Winter Haven's humidity?
Florida's year-round humidity creates constant condensation problems with older windows. When warm, moist air hits cool glass surfaces, you get that annoying fog and moisture buildup between panes. This happens because your window seals have failed, letting humid air penetrate the space between glass layers. Modern replacement windows use advanced seal technology and low-E coatings that prevent this moisture intrusion while keeping your home more comfortable.
What windows survive Florida hurricane season?
All replacement windows in Winter Haven must meet Florida Building Code R4402 for wind resistance. This means your new windows need to withstand sustained winds and flying debris during storms. We install impact-resistant windows or standard windows with approved storm shutters, depending on your budget and preferences. How much do replacement windows cost in Winter Haven?
Window replacement costs vary based on your home's size, window style, and performance features you choose. Most Winter Haven homeowners invest between $400-800 per window for quality replacement units that meet Florida's hurricane codes. Can I get energy rebates for new windows in Florida?
Florida Power & Light offers rebates for ENERGY STAR certified windows that meet specific performance criteria. These rebates can reduce your replacement cost while lowering your monthly cooling bills. We help you navigate the rebate process and ensure your new windows qualify for available incentives. Combined with federal tax credits, these programs make window replacement more affordable for Winter Haven families.
Do I need HOA approval for window replacement?
Many Winter Haven neighborhoods require HOA approval before replacing windows, especially if you're changing colors or styles. How long does window installation take?
Most Winter Haven homes need 1-2 days for complete window replacement, depending on the number of windows and any unexpected issues we discover.
